Bandar Pinggiran Subang in Petaling, Selangor recorded 11 subsale transactions in 2024, with a median price of RM 780K and a median price per square foot (PSF) of RM 396.

This area contains both residential and commercial properties. View 20 residential properties or 13 commercial properties separately for more focused analysis.

Price remained flat, and PSF growth was PSF remained flat. The median price is RM 780K, with most transactions falling within a stable range of RM 498K to RM 1.28 million, and a typical market range of RM 605K to RM 955K.

Most transactions involved 2 - 2 1/2 storey terraced, with high diversity across multiple property types.

Price per square foot shows a median of RM 396, though individual units vary from RM 185 to RM 608 in the core range. The broader market spans RM 330.68 to RM 461.68, indicating diverse property characteristics. A wider spread (IQR: RM 131.00) and deviation (MAD: RM 212) indicate significant PSF variations, likely due to diverse property types or conditions.
